FunctionFoxFunctionFox is recommended for creative professionals, design firms, marketing agencies, and similar organizations that need an intuitive platform for managing billable hours, project timelines, and team collaboration. Its features are particularly valuable for teams that have multiple clients and projects to manage simultaneously.

Daily task automation is a powerful tool for enhancing efficiency, productivity, and well-being. By automating repetitive tasks, individuals and businesses can save time, reduce errors, and focus on creative and strategic work. With tools like Todoist, Zapier, and Fireflies, automation is more accessible than ever.
